@Chrisbaker1 : Do you have more than 1 no. on your a/c? If you have more than 1 number on your MyEE a/c you can't use text to 65075 to get your PAC but will need to call CS for it.

@Jank0x : Contracts don't roll over to PAYG unless you ask for them to do so. These mobile contracts don't just end, just the min. term expires. They are not fixed term contracts. After the min. term they just carry on at the same price on a rolling 30-days' notice basis until you explicitly cancel or upgrade.
